How blogging is changing people’s lifestyles


In simple terms, a blog is a website or diary where you can place information of interest, where the reader can post a feedback for everyone else to see. It is a simplified site, which can consist of series of entries and conversations.

It’s easier to drive traffic to a blog than to a traditional website. Bloggers are more inclined to link to their competitors, and therefore if you write good content you should be able to get coverage much quicker than other internet media businesses. Also, when you get more links from other bloggers you will also get more search engine traffic too.
